False accusation and politicians: Maulana Fazal-ur-Rehman slams Pakistan PM Imran Khan

| @indiablooms | Oct 03, 2020, at 04:46 am

Islamabad:  Jamiat Ulema-e-Islam president Maulana Fazal-ur-Rehman has targeted Pakistan PM Imran Khan and said his government is framing politicians under false accusations.

The National Accountability Bureau (NAB) had earlier summoned the Pakistani politician.

Addressing a gathering here, Rehman accused the NAB, a federal executive agency of the Pakistan government, for running a “parallel government”, reports ANI.

“The law is irrelevant for them if we wanted to survive like this in Pakistan, then why did we start the fight for independence?” said Rehman.

Terming the Pakistan leadership as “the puppets of America”, he was quoted as saying by ANI: “Pakistan is my home. I do not think of you as the heir of Pakistan. I am an independent man. We do not fight, but think carefully before moving on.”
